How to move an area after logging in to Mural

Here is how to move an area after logging in to mural

  1. First click on "Murals" in the left sidebar menu after logging in to Mural
  2. Then click on the mural that you want to manage to open it
  3. Next click on the freeform area to select it
  4. Then click on the "Hand" tool in the left toolbar
  5. Finally click and drag on the canvas to your selected area
